Here is an example of the wonderful architecture in my neighborhood. I love every one of these houses in the “Harris Row.” It’s a beautiful row! The houses in the row were originally built all alike. Many of them still have intact interiors.
I love these houses so much in this row because they are minii-mansions: small scale only a bit bigger than my house but fully appointed. They have wonderful millwork, pocket doors, ceiling medallions, and most of them still have a back staircase.
